Gulf Arabic
What is Gulf Arabic?
Gulf Arabic (also called Khaleeji) is the Arabic language variant spoken by the locals of the United Arab Emirates (Dubai, Abu Dhabi, Sharjah, etc.), Qatar, Kuwait, Bahrain, parts of eastern Saudi Arabia, most of Southern Iraq and, to a lesser extent, Oman.
Why learn Gulf Arabic?
It is the mother tongue of Gulf Arabs and a prestige dialect. It is used in day-to-day interactions, in business, in TV/radio talk shows, movies and music.
